Siemens basic plc programming pdf

Automation technology industry software automation software tia portal plc programming step 7 professional tia portal automation technology industry software automation software tia portal plc programming step 7 basic tia portal. Simatic step 7 tia portal continues the success story of simatic step 7. Simatic step 7 basic tia portal is a priceoptimized subset of step 7 professional controller software in the tia portal. Siemens makes several plc product lines in the simatic s7. Siemens plc programming training tutorial counters bin95. Review of siemens simatic step 7 lite programming software. All names identified by are registered trademarks of the siemens ag. The focus includes configuration of the siemens s71500 plc hardware, profinet configuration, programming using ladder logic and basic diagnostic functions. So no programming for the s7200 or s7400 plc series. Siemens simatic s7 manuals and guides southern plcs. Both the system manual and the easy book are available as electronic pdf manuals. The module a3 is assigned content wise to the basics of step 7 programming and represents a quick start in the step7 programming.

Lecture plc programming basics mme 486 fall 2006 of 62 program scan during each operating cycle, the processor reads all inputs, takes these values, and energizes or deenergizes the outputs according to the user program. What is the most basic plc software to learn plc programming. Programmable logic controllers plc in brief, are considered today as a principal item of automation. As the basic tool for simatic, step 7 handles the parenthesis function for totally integrated automation. Chapter 1 introduction overview basic concepts chapter 2 s71200 plcs s71200 plc overview s71200 with safety integrated chapter 3 s71200 plc programming programming concepts lad programming basics lad timers and counters chapter 4. Basic steps in plc programming for beginners photo credit. This fast paced three day course assumes the student has a basic knowledge of programming plcs and focuses on how to use tia portal step 7 professional software to create a complete plc system. Plus our first plc programming example video using the siemens plc simulator came out a little blurry. The basics of siemens plcs and programming in simatic step7.

This course covers basics of plcs and related products. Siemens industry catalog automation technology industry software automation software tia portal plc programming step 7 basic tia portal login registration. S bharadwaj reddy september 21, 2019 november 27, 2019. January 16, 2017 a programmable logic controller plc, also referred to as a programmable controller, is the name given to a type of computer commonly used in commercial and industrial control applications. Review of siemens simatic step 7 lite programming software great taste. The basics of siemens plcs and programming in simatic. Ladder logic lad for s7300 and s7400 programming reference manual, 052010, a5e0279007901 5 online help the manual is complemented by an online help which is integrated in the software. Plc memory ladder logic program runs output image plc memory state of actual output device as the ladder logic program is scanned, it reads the input data table then writes to a portion of plc memory the output data, table as it executes the output data table is copied to the actual output devices after the ladder logic has been scanned. This manual is your guide to creating user programs in the statement list programming language ladder logic. Beginners guide to plc programming how to program a plc programmable logic controller. Automation software tia portal plc programming step 7 basic. In addition, we introduce librarycompatible function and function block programming. Plc programming tutorial allen bradley training in rslogix 5000 ladder logic basics for beginners duration. Basic plc programming how to program a plc using ladder.

This ebook, along with the online tutorial, provides an example of how to automate a drill press, while explaining all the basic concepts of plc programming that are necessary to write a solid plc program. Step 7 offers an engineering solution for basic automation tasks as it can be used for both, programming the simatic s71200 basic controllers and configuring simatic hmi basic panels. Introduction and basic parts of ladder diagram in plc programming february 22, 2020 august 19, 2018 by dipali chaudhari today, i will explain to you about the ladder diagram in plc programming and different parts of the ladder diagram. In this chapter, you will get to know the basic elements of a control program the organization blocks obs, functions fcs, function blocks fbs and data blocks dbs. Working with step 7 this is a basic introduction to step 7 which walks through an example of. Ladder logic lad for s7300 and s7400 programming siemens. The slot and rack plcs are modular and very variable. Lecture plc programming basics mme 486 fall 2006 20 of 62 plc programming languages the term plc programming languagerefers to the method by which the user communicates information to the plc. This course introduces the participant to the siemens 1200 plc hardware and software and will build skills on programming, installation, commissioning and basic fault diagnostics, utilising a hmi and plc, profinet communications network. The purpose of a plc was to directly replace electromechanical relays as logic elements. This course is not for people with prior plc knowledge and programming.

The basic elements of a plc include input modules or points, a central processing unit cpu, output modules or points, and a programming device. Cmon over to where you can learn plc programming faster and easier than you ever thought possible. Aug 30, 2017 plc programming tutorial allen bradley training in rslogix 5000 ladder logic basics for beginners duration. The training aim of this course is to teach the basic instructions of a plc with a strong element of practical, handson simulation of industrial related circuits. Ladder logic is not only a programming language for plcs. Simatic s7 plc programmingbasic level based on s7300400. This online help is intended to provide you with detailed support when using the software. Our goal is to make it comprehensive as possible, providing not only the generic principles in all plcs, but to give practical examples from many different plc manufacturers. Forward appendix i is the requirement for the processing of the module of the theme basics of step 7 programming. Sep 04, 2017 one of the best visual programming languages is a plc programming language.

Siemens s71500 programming with tia portal training. Siemens has broadly 3 plc ranges ie siemens s7 200, 300 and 400. So we offer the additional counter plc programming example content below to supplement the video. Sep 15, 2014 cmon over to where you can learn plc programming faster and easier than you ever thought possible. Introduction and basic parts of ladder diagram in plc. Nov 25, 2019 the iec has published the iec 611 standard for plcs which should be followed by all users worldwide, and it has a section specifically for plc programming languages, the iec 61. The s7200 has a brick design which means that the power supply and io are onboard. Siemens simatic step 7 programmers handbook plcdev. Ladder diagram primary programming language for plcs. Use the plc tags in the tag table for addressing the instructions. The siemens plc programming tutorial counters video has a little repetition in it, but more wont hurt. This course is meant to supply you with basic information on the functions and configurations of plcs with emphasis on the s7200 plc family. Siemens tia portal step 7 wincc plc hmi plcs udemy.

This course is aimed at engineering personnel who program, install or maintain automation systems and their application programs. Ladder logic diagrams can be read by the programming console for this reason, ladder diagrams need to be converted into mnuemonic codes that provides same information as ladder diagrams and to be typed directly using programming console. Theory and implementation programmable controllers an industrial text company publication atlanta georgia usa second edition l. Basics of plc programming in the late 1960s an american company named bedford associates released a computing device they called the modicon. It is one of the standardized plc programming languages. The basics of siemens plcs and programming in simatic step7 published. Pdf automating with step 7 in lad and fbd simatic s7300400. Meirc offers simatic s7 plc programmingbasic level based on s7300400 and other handson automation and process control related training courses in. A complete plc programming course finally, a plc course developed for real learning by a real plc programmer with.

Forward function and design of a plc programming language step 7 2. With simatic step 7 tia portal users configure, program, test and diagnose the basic, advanced and distributed controllers of each generation, whether it is plc or pcbased, incl. The programmable logic controller plc monitors and controls your machine with. The siemens s7200 plc is a very popular choice, when you start plc programming.

The iec has published the iec 611 standard for plcs which should be followed by all users worldwide, and it has a section specifically for plc programming languages, the iec 61. All of the imo gseries range uses the same programming software, the iec61 compliant. Understand the four basic pieces of logic see what a relay does and why we need to. Siemens plc interview questions and answers plc tutorials. Aug 19, 2018 introduction and basic parts of ladder diagram in plc programming february 22, 2020 august 19, 2018 by dipali chaudhari today, i will explain to you about the ladder diagram in plc programming and different parts of the ladder diagram. Jan 16, 2017 the basics of siemens plcs and programming in simatic step7 published. Plcdev has developed this instruction manual plc basics in hopes it will serve the beginner to the advanced user. Basics of plc programming industrial control systems fall 2006. They can be specified to meet the application more precisely.

Simatic step 7 basic plc programming with simatic step 7. Step 7 is used to carry out the configuration and programming of the simatic s7, simatic c7 and simatic winac automation systems. Its everything you need and want to develop a high comfort level with siemens technology. Using the simatic s7 programmable controllers as example, this book provides an insight into the hardware and software configuration of the controller, presents the programming level with its various languages, explains the exchange of data over networks, and describes the numerous possibilities for operator control and monitoring of the process. Appendix i fundamentals of plc industrial automation siemens. Identify the major components of a plc and describe their functions convert numbers from decimal to binary, bcd, and hexadecimal. Preface, contents product overview 1 getting started 2 installing the s7200 3 plc concepts 4 programming concepts, conventions and features 5 s7200 instruction set 6 communicating over a network 7 hardware troubleshooting guide and software debugging tools 8 open loop motion control with the s7200 9 creating a program for the modem module 10. Youll learn plc programming in only days from this course.

This course will give a person with no prior experience the basic tools necessary to create a plc program from scratch. This training program for siemens simatic manager v5. For those of you who might not think youre ready, you can always take a. Forward function and design of a plc program language step 7 1. Outline introduction to programming software ladder diagram basic logic functions mnuemonic code cxprogrammer. Plc programming is a logical procedure in a plc program, things inputs and rungs are either true or false. S7 1200 basic course tiamicro1 index, siemens training. Lecture plc programming basics mme 486 fall 2006 2 of 62. As an acronym, it meant mod ular di gital con troller, and later became the name of a company division devoted to the design, manufacture, and sale of these specialpurpose control computers. Microsoft windows has been selected as the operating system, thus opening up the world of standard pcs with. Gradually practice while you learn and soon youll be programming. But even simple bit logic operations can be very useful in more advanced plc programs and in scada system programming. Programmable logic controller siemens what are the various plc system in simatic s7 range. Basic knowledge required the manual is intended for s7 programmers, operators, and maintenanceservice personnel.

So youll be creating plc programs, creating hmi projects, simulating both and making them talk to each other. The siemens s7200 has a limited variety of functions, but it certainly also has a lot of advantages. It is the cheapest plc from siemens, and it is very easy to begin programming. The people or the organization that sets the standards for ladder logic is plcopen.

Upon completion of basics of plcs you should be able to. Basics of plc programming plc tutorials for beginners. As an already registered user simply enter your userame and password in the login page in the appropriate fields. Siemens s7 family this handbook is a collection of programming overviews, notes, helps, cheat sheets and whatever that can help you and me program a siemens plc.

Plc basics plcdev plcdev tools for plc programming. The second step in control program development is to determine a control strategy, the sequence of processing steps that must occur within a program to produce the desired output control. The basics of siemens plc s and programming in simatic step7. Plc programming language refers to the set of semantics or methods that allow the user to communicate information to the plc. All the plcs can be interlinked and share data within their own dedicated network. In a plc program, things inputs and rungs are either true or false. This section covers programmable logic controller, plc programming examples. Every example program includes the description of the problem, the solution as well as plc code, explanation and run time test cases of the problem. Create a function fc for a valve logic in siemens plc. In this manual, you will get to know the basics of simatic step 7. Pdf automating with step 7 in lad and fbd simatic s7. Its called ladder logic or ladder diagram ld and you can learn it very fast the smart thing about ladder logic is that it looks very similar to electrical relay circuits. The manual also includes a reference section that describes the syntax and functions of the language elements of ladder logic.

S7200 the s7200 is referred to as a micro plc because of its small size. Data movement, floating point math, shift, compare, distribute, collection, transfer, and other instructions will be covered. These examples can be simple plc programs or advanced plc programs. Innovative engineering for both proven and new simatic controllers. This guide does not cover technical details regarding the setting of the fa system or plc programming after purchase. Automation software tia portal plc programming step 7. If you have experience with siemens then please contribute. Computer aided manufacturing tech 453350 2 ladder logic learning objectives understand basic ladder logic symbol write ladder logic for simple applications translate relay ladder logic into plc ladder logic. The best way to learn plc programming is through udemy professional training video courses. Introduction and basic parts of ladder diagram in plc programming.

1555 254 339 236 1124 699 506 284 1622 771 75 440 1173 1668 112 990 127 1614 1637 1124 1321 1507 1483 1495 1037 1069 604 652 757 1339 1061 111 1508 708 539 78 251 903 1231 199 955 1343 870 266 68 562